Cordoba Province: A Tapestry of Cultural Marvels Nestled in the heart of Argentina, a captivating destination that seamlessly blends history, architecture, and natural beauty. With its rich heritage and diverse landscapes, this province offers an enchanting experience for every traveler. In Spain's Andalucia region lies another Cordoba, known for its iconic landmarks such as the elevated view of the Cathedral of Cordoba. This architectural masterpiece showcases a fusion of Islamic and Christian influences, leaving visitors awe-inspired by its intricate details. Further exploring Andalucia's treasures brings you to Almodovar del Rio Castle. Perched majestically on a hilltop overlooking Cordoba, this medieval fortress stands as a testament to centuries past and provides breathtaking panoramic views. Delving deeper into history takes you to Madinat al Zahra archeological site - the Palace City. Once an opulent city built by Caliph Abd-ar-Rahman III in the 10th century, it now reveals remnants of grandeur through its ruins and transports visitors back in time. A UNESCO World Heritage Site awaits in Mezquita Catedral (Mosque-Cathedral), where Islamic architecture merges harmoniously with Gothic elements. Its mesmerizing interior boasts an impressive forest of columns that create an ethereal atmosphere like no other. Crossing continents back to Argentina's Cordoba unveils yet more wonders. The twilight view of the Cordoba Cabildo presents a colonial town hall steeped in history against a backdrop painted with hues reminiscent of dusk - truly magical. Venturing into Villa General Belgrano within Cordoba Province rewards travelers with elevated views that showcase picturesque landscapes dotted with charming houses nestled amidst rolling hills. Don't miss out on experiencing their vibrant Oktoberfest Gate during festivities. Nature enthusiasts will find solace in Calamuchita Valley's waterfall at La Cumbrecita.
